Es ist bekannt, dafs das Wassergas häufig flüchtige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en enthält. Bei der Verwendung des Wassergases als Leuchtgas in der Gasglühlichtbeleuchtung (Auerlicht) rufen schon ganz geringe Mengen dieser eigenthümlichen Körper sehr unliebsame Störungen hervor. Beim Brennen des Gases zersetzen sich nämlich diese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en und bewirken unter Bildung eines braunen Belags — wahrscheinlich von Eisenoxyd — auf den Glühstrümpfen sehr bald eine beträchtliche Abnahme der Leuchtkraft derselben.It is known that the water gas often contains volatile iron carbon oxide compounds. When using the water gas as illuminating gas in the gas incandescent lighting (Auerlicht), even very small quantities call these peculiar bodies produce very unpleasant disturbances. When the gas burns This is because these iron carbon oxide compounds decompose and cause formation a brown coating - probably of iron oxide - on the mantles soon a considerable decrease in luminosity.
Zur Unschädlichmachung dieser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en hat man bisher vorgeschlagen, das Wassergas durch glühende Röhren oder durch geeignete Säuren zu leiten (vergl. Patentschrift 72816). In jüngster Zeit hat Bunte gefunden, dafs Xylol die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en kräftig absorbirt, und daher diesen Kohlenwasserstoff als Reinigungsmittel empfohlen.To render these iron carbon oxide compounds harmless, it has been proposed to date to conduct the water gas through glowing pipes or through suitable acids (see patent specification 72816). Recently Bunte has found that xylene is the iron-carbon compound strongly absorbed, and therefore recommended this hydrocarbon as a cleaning agent.
Es hat sich nun gezeigt, dafs diese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en durch Oxydation mittelst geeigneter Oxydationsmittel vollständig und leicht zerstört werden können, ohne dafs dabei die übrigen Bestandtheile des Wassergases angegriffen werden. Eine ganze Reihe der bekannten und üblichen Oxydationsmittel sind zu diesem Zweck geeignet. Man kann sie in flüssiger oder fester Form mit ungefähr gleichem Erfolg verwenden. Von flüssigen Oxydationsmitteln liefert besonders Bromwasser günstige Resultate (vergl. z.B. Moniteur scientifique 1892, S. 788, Abs. 4 und S. 791, Abs. 4). Es hat aber den Nachtheil, dafs die Reinigung mit demselben in der Centrale selbst geschehen mufs, was die Aufstellung eines besonderen Skrubbers, den das Wassergas zu durchströmen hat, bedingt. Es ist bei dieser Art der Anlage aufserdem die Möglichkeit und Gefahr vorhanden, dafs das in der Centrale gereinigte Wassergas auf seinem Wege von dort durch das Röhrennetz zur Verbrauchsstelle wieder Eisenkohlenoxyd bildet, die vorherige Zerstörung desselben also illusorisch wird. Die gleichen Uebelstände zeigt überdies die von Strache (Patentschrift 72816) empfohlene Methode: Durchleitung des Gases durch Säuren. Auch das Bunte'sche Xylolverfahren ist hiervon nicht ganz frei.It has now been shown that these iron-carbon oxide compounds are by means of oxidation suitable oxidizing agents can be completely and easily destroyed without this the remaining components of the water gas are attacked. A number of the well-known and common oxidizing agents are closed suitable for this purpose. You can get them in liquid or solid form with about the same thing Use success. Of the liquid oxidizing agents, bromine water is particularly cheap Results (see e.g. Moniteur scientifique 1892, p. 788, para. 4 and p. 791, para. 4). It has but the disadvantage that the purification takes place with it in the central station itself mufs what the installation of a special scrubber through which the water gas flows has, conditionally. With this type of system, there is also the possibility and danger of that the water gas purified in the central station on its way from there through the Pipe network to the point of use forms iron carbon oxide again, the previous destruction it therefore becomes illusory. The same evils, moreover, are shown by that of Strache (Patent specification 72816) Recommended method: Passing the gas through acids. Even Bunte's xylene process is not entirely free of this.
Diese Uebelstände werden aber vollständig vermieden, wenn an Stelle von flüssigen bezw. wässerigen Lösungen von Oxydationsmitteln solche in fester trockener Form zur Zerstörung der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en im Wassergas benutzt werden.These inconveniences are completely avoided if instead of liquid or aqueous solutions of oxidizing agents those in solid dry form for destruction of the iron carbon oxide compounds in water gas.
Angestellte Versuche haben das überraschende Resultat ergeben, dafs es zur Befreiung des Wassergases von den in ihm enthaltenen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en genügt, wenn man das Gas eine Schicht eines geeigneten trockenen, am besten mit porösen Stoffen gemischten Oxydationsmittels durchströmen läfst. Insbesondere sind es übermangansäure Salze, die, in trockener Form angewendet, die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en des Wassergases rasch vollständig unschädlich machen. Aehnlich wirken auch chromsaure Salze oder oxydische Eisensalze, Eisenchlorid etc. Diese EigenschaftAttempts made have shown the surprising result that it leads to the liberation of the Water gas from the iron carbon oxide compounds contained in it is sufficient if the gas is a layer of a suitable one flow through dry oxidizing agent, preferably mixed with porous materials running. In particular, it is super-manganic acid salts that, when applied in dry form, are the Quickly render iron carbon oxide compounds of the water gas completely harmless. Similar Chromic acid salts or oxidic iron salts, iron chloride etc. also have an effect. This property
der Übermangansauren Salze gestattet eine einfache und praktische Ausführung des Reinigungsverfahrens. the super-manganese acid salts allows a simple and practical execution of the purification process.
Eine oder mehrere mit den Oxydationsmitteln, vorzugsweise übermangansaurem Kali oder saurem chromsaurem Kali, oder auch Eisenoxydsalzen bezw. Eisenchlorid gefüllte Patronen werden zweckmäfsig direkt vor' oder unmittelbar hinter der Gasuhr in das Leitungsnetz eingeschaltet, so dafs das aus der Gasuhr ein- bezw. austretende Wassergas dieselben durchströmen mufs. Um dem Oxydationsmittel gröfsere Wirkungsfläche zu geben, ist es vortheilhaft, dasselbe mit einem geeigneten porösen Material, wie z. B. Kieseiguhr und Bimsstein, zu mischen bezw. das poröse Material mit einer Lösung des Oxydationsmittels zu tränken und dann zu trocknen. Die Füllung der Patrone mit dem Oxydationsmittel und die Einschaltung derselben in das Leitungsnetz geschieht in üblicher Weise.One or more with the oxidizing agents, preferably super-manganese potash or acidic chromic acid potash, or iron oxide salts respectively. Ferric chloride filled Cartridges are expediently placed directly in front of or immediately behind the gas meter in the pipe network switched on, so that the gas meter can be switched on or off. exiting water gas the same must flow through. In order to give the oxidizing agent a larger effective surface, it is advantageous to the same with a suitable porous material, such as. B. Kieseiguhr and pumice stone, to mix resp. impregnating the porous material with a solution of the oxidizing agent and then to dry. The cartridge is filled with the oxidizing agent and the same is switched on into the network in the usual way.
Es ist ersichtlich, dafs bei dieser Ausführungsform der Gefahr der Wiederbildung der Eisenkohlenoxydverbindungen im Leitungsnetz nach vorausgegangener Reinigung des Gases in der Centrale vorgebeugt wird. Gasglühlichtbrenner, die mit derartig gereinigtem Wassergas gespeist werden, behalten ihre natürliche Leuchtkraft und Lebensdauer.It can be seen that in this embodiment there is a risk of the iron carbon oxide compounds being formed again in the pipeline network after previous cleaning of the gas in the central station is prevented. Gas incandescent burner, those that are fed with water gas purified in this way retain their natural luminosity and lifespan.
